About Silvana Estrada
Silvana Estrada is a prodigious talent who has rapidly ascended to become one of Latin America’s most compelling musical voices. Born in Veracruz, Mexico, and later spending her formative years in Canada, Estrada’s musical tapestry is rich with influences from both her heritage and her international experiences. Her early exposure to folk traditions, coupled with a natural inclination towards introspection, has shaped her unique artistic identity. Estrada’s breakthrough came with her critically lauded debut album, “Marchita,” released in 2020. The album, a deeply personal exploration of heartbreak and resilience, garnered widespread praise for its poetic lyrics and stripped-back arrangements. Her distinctive vocal delivery, often accompanied by her own masterful command of the Venezuelan cuatro, creates an intimate and almost hypnotic atmosphere.
She is perhaps best known for her poignant single “Marchita,” a song that encapsulates the melancholic beauty and vulnerability that has become her signature. Other notable tracks like “Te Guardo” and “Un Día con Tu Luz” further showcase her lyrical prowess and her ability to connect with listeners on a profound emotional level. Estrada’s music often delves into themes of love, loss, identity, and the complexities of the human heart, all delivered with an honesty that is both disarming and deeply affecting. Her live performances are celebrated for their unvarnished authenticity, drawing audiences into a shared space of emotional exploration. With each performance, Silvana Estrada solidifies her reputation as an artist who possesses a rare gift for translating the deepest of human emotions into exquisite musical offerings.
Venue Information
The Teatro Metropólitan, a historic and architecturally significant venue located in the heart of Ciudad de México, offers a sublime setting for an evening of exceptional music. Renowned for its opulent interiors and excellent acoustics, it has played host to countless legendary artists, providing an intimate yet grand atmosphere for performances.
